Matt Levine Introduces #LESbeat Dinner Series

Fresh off opening Cocktail Bodega and organizing a Red Buill-sponsored Chinatown rave (Cam’ron and Riff Raff performed), we are told Matt Levine is continuing the co-branding relationship with an intimate weekly dinner series. The word is that #LESbeat is now a Monday night meal plan with local movers and shakers, hosted at a rotating roster of restaurants around the neighborhood. The two-month-long program started this week at Mission Chinese, with future venues to include Fat Radish, Barrio Chino, 169 Bar, Congee Village, Grey Lady, and Vanessa’s Dumplings.
After learning about the venture, we reached out to Levine and received the following comment:
The #LESbeat feedback and turnout was overwhelming, so myself, the Brandsway Creative and Redbull team decided to continue the concept on a smaller scale, 10-15 person dinners, bringing different creative types of neighborhood people together, throughout the Lower East Side every week for the next 2 months.
Nightlife networking with a small group of folks. Apparently this is a hot ticket and access is invite-only.
